Following Chelsea’s dramatic 4-3 comeback victory against rivals Tottenham on Sunday, a result that propelled them into a clear second position in the Premier League table, fans were asked for their perspectives. Here are some of their comments: Dean remarked, “Chelsea played like title contenders today. That’s how title contenders play – they forget about mistakes made in the game, pick their heads up, and make it right.” Agu stated, “Aside from the first 15 minutes, Chelsea were superb. They stuck to the plan. It was a huge statement win.” Nick commented, “A great Chelsea comeback, helped by the standard Spurs implosion. After gifting Spurs two early goals it was very much in the Christmas spirit for them to hand us two gifts in return. But Chelsea will struggle to stay in the top four if we continue to ship so many goals. Not every team will be as generous as our North London neighbours.” Kevin observed, “Chelsea showed guts, character and class. In Cole Palmer we have the best player in the league. 12 out of 12 penalties beating Toure’s 11. Enzo’s changes at half time were very good – I wasn’t sure about him but I’m happy he’s proving me wrong.” Doug shared his view, “Chelsea have character this season. They didn’t panic going 2-0 down early in the game and let their football do the talking. Enzo is bringing out the best in the team, though he’s got to sort out the goalkeeper situation. However, can’t think of winning a title with a dodgy keeper.” Nigel expressed, “I’ve been disappointed in Enzo Fernandez. Not recently, he is at last beginning to show he might be worth some of his massive fee.”
